what's your rig specs and how many FPS do you get in val?

so my lil bro was using my old pc, Ryzen 3 2200g - 16gb - rx 570, decent enough to run val with 200fps back when i was using it in 2021.
but then lately the fps almost halved, now it only can run val about 100-120fps, sometimes even dipped to 80fps in chaotic scenario.
anyone have this kinda problem also? because my current rig does not have it.

Val is slowly getting harder to run every year and that cpu was a very low budget option from 7 years ago. But fortunately you're already on the AM4 socket so it will be very easy to upgrade depending on what motherboard you have. I recommend upgrading to ryzen 5 3600 or 5500 if you're on a budget and it will doubled or maybe even tripled the current fps.
